Vietnam C.bank keeps central exchange rate steady, black market dong stronger, Thursday

On February 12, in Vietnam, the black market US dollar buy rate was VND 26,200, and the sell rate was VND 26,250, a change of 20 and 20, respectively, for a mid-market rate of VND 26,225 (down 0.08 percent), according to prices quoted by Ty Gia USD. Meanwhile, the State Bank of Vietnam’s central exchange rate was set at VND 25,050, while the Google Finance mid-market rate stood at VND 25,964.
